Handover Note — Director Transition

From the outgoing to the incoming finance director, for board reference. The Q4 cash-flow forecast for Ashgrove Components is complete and conservative: operating inflows steady, capex deferred on the Milldane press line, and the revolving facility untouched. Assumptions and sensitivities are in the shared workbook. One forecast driver is confidential and is recorded immediately below for board eyes only.

board note of baweg-bawig: Project Tamath slips by six weeks because of the audit delay.

**Q: How do I move between floors during weekend lift maintenance?**

Both passenger lifts at Dunmore House are out of service from 20:00 Friday to 06:00 Monday while Kestrel Lifts carries out scheduled maintenance. Night-shift staff should use the north stairwell, which stays unlocked throughout. The goods lift remains available for heavy items but must be booked through the duty supervisor. Deliveries arriving overnight go via the basement ramp. The stairwell door on each floor is secured; entry requires the code below.

staff pass of kawip-hawef = bdg-QLP-2

**Mgmt Meeting Minutes — Retiring the Brightline Range**

Quick recap for sales leads at Fenholt Supplies: we agreed to retire the Brightline fixture range by year-end. Remaining stock moves to clearance pricing next month, and accounts on standing orders get migrated to the Lumetta range. Trade-in incentives were approved in principle. The confidential note on next steps sits just below.

board note of bajof-bajeg: The pricing group signed off on a budget of $13.4 million for Project Sildor. The renewal with Lamixek Holdings closes at $48.9 million a year, 49 percent above the last contract.